Since the creation of DFA over 2,000 students have participated in campus studios, 17 campus studios have been created, two start ups (SwipeSense and Jerry the Bear) have come to market and raised $1.5 million in funding. Furthermore, DFA has become nationally recognized through publicity such as New York Times, Chicago Tribue, Forbes, and MIT Technology Review. DFA has recieved several awards, invites to conferences, and grants. Lastly, DFA reports that employers consistantly search out students from DFA campus studio groups for hiring because of their experiences while in DFA .
